Enhancing Your Phoenix Apartment

After settling into your Phoenix apartment, employing smart storage solutions is vital. Vertical storage options, like wall-mounted shelves and hanging organizers, effectively utilize wall space for storage. Multi-functional furniture, such as beds with drawers or storage ottomans, provide dual functionality without taking up additional space. Discovering hidden storage opportunities, like spaces under the bed or behind doors, can greatly improve the organization and efficiency of your living area.

Creating Space with Style

In neighborhoods where space is a premium, crafting an illusion of more space is essential. Consider using light, soft color schemes to visually enlarge your space. Strategically placed mirrors can add depth and reflect light, making compact areas feel larger. Choose furniture that fits the scale of your apartment to avoid overcrowding, balancing functionality and aesthetic appeal.

Lighting Solutions for Spacious Ambiance

Lighting plays a crucial role in transforming the feel of your apartment. Bright, well-lit rooms appear more open. Layer different light sources for a dynamic effect and choose sleek fixtures like wall sconces or pendant lights that don’t consume much space. Maximize natural light with sheer curtains and unobstructed windows, using mirrors to reflect daylight.

Tech-Forward Living

Incorporate smart home technology for space-saving and modern living. Voice-activated assistants and integrated systems control lighting, temperature, and entertainment without bulky hardware. Updated home appliances, designed for small-space living, such as compact dishwashers and combo washer-dryers, offer functionality tailored for urban apartments.

Revamping Layouts for Better Living

Consider changing your apartment’s layout for improved functionality and comfort. Create open plans for better flow or add partitions for privacy. Always check with building management and local regulations before making structural changes. Consult with architects or interior designers specializing in small spaces for professional insight.

  1. Studio Apartment Layout:

    • Redesign Idea: Create distinct zones using furniture and rugs. For example, position a sofa to separate the living area from the sleeping space. Use a bookshelf as a partition to add privacy and additional storage.
  2. One-Bedroom Apartment Layout:

    • Redesign Idea: Optimize the living room by incorporating a wall-mounted fold-down desk or table to create a multipurpose space that can serve as a dining area, workspace, or entertaining spot.
  3. Two-Bedroom Apartment Layout:

    • Redesign Idea: If the second bedroom is small, consider converting it into a home office or a multifunctional space with a sofa bed. This allows for a guest room when needed while providing a practical space for everyday use.
